怎么用excel算投资组合回报率

怎么用excel算投资组合回报率

在Excel中计算投资组合回报率的方法包括:使用基本公式、权重平均法、XIRR函数。使用基本公式可以让你清楚地了解每个投资项目的贡献,权重平均法有助于综合考虑各个投资项目的比例,XIRR函数则为你提供了更复杂的时间序列回报计算。下面将详细介绍如何在Excel中使用这些方法计算投资组合回报率。

一、使用基本公式

1.1 计算单个投资项目的回报率

首先,你需要计算每个投资项目的回报率。公式为:

[ text{回报率} = frac{text{期末价值} – text{期初价值} + text{分红}}{text{期初价值}} ]

在Excel中,你可以使用以下步骤来计算单个投资项目的回报率:

  1. 输入数据:在Excel表格中输入每个投资项目的期初价值、期末价值和分红。
  2. 计算回报率:在一个新的单元格中输入公式。例如,如果期初价值在A2,期末价值在B2,分红在C2,你可以在D2单元格中输入公式:
    =(B2 - A2 + C2) / A2

1.2 汇总所有投资项目的回报率

将所有单个投资项目的回报率汇总起来,可以得到整个投资组合的回报率。你可以使用“平均”函数来进行汇总:

  1. 计算每个投资项目的回报率:如上所述,在每个投资项目的回报率列中输入公式。
  2. 计算平均回报率:在一个新的单元格中输入公式。例如,如果你的回报率列是D2到D10,你可以在D11单元格中输入公式:
    =AVERAGE(D2:D10)

二、权重平均法

权重平均法考虑了每个投资项目在整个投资组合中的比例,可以更准确地反映整体回报率。

2.1 计算每个投资项目的权重

首先,你需要计算每个投资项目在整个投资组合中的权重。公式为:

[ text{权重} = frac{text{期初价值}}{text{总期初价值}} ]

在Excel中,你可以使用以下步骤来计算每个投资项目的权重:

  1. 输入数据:在Excel表格中输入每个投资项目的期初价值。
  2. 计算总期初价值:在一个新的单元格中输入公式。例如,如果期初价值列是A2到A10,你可以在A11单元格中输入公式:
    =SUM(A2:A10)

  3. 计算权重:在一个新的单元格中输入公式。例如,如果期初价值在A2,总期初价值在A11,你可以在B2单元格中输入公式:
    =A2 / $A$11

2.2 计算每个投资项目的权重回报率

将每个投资项目的回报率乘以其权重,可以得到权重回报率:

  1. 计算权重回报率:在一个新的单元格中输入公式。例如,如果回报率在D2,权重在B2,你可以在E2单元格中输入公式:
    =D2 * B2

2.3 汇总所有投资项目的权重回报率

将所有投资项目的权重回报率汇总起来,可以得到整个投资组合的加权平均回报率:

  1. 计算加权平均回报率:在一个新的单元格中输入公式。例如,如果你的权重回报率列是E2到E10,你可以在E11单元格中输入公式:
    =SUM(E2:E10)

三、使用XIRR函数

XIRR函数可以用于计算不规则现金流的内部回报率(IRR),特别适用于有多个现金流入和流出的投资组合。

3.1 准备数据

首先,你需要准备好所有的现金流数据,包括投资和回报的日期和金额。

  1. 输入数据:在Excel表格中输入每个现金流的日期和金额。例如,日期列在A2到A10,金额列在B2到B10。

3.2 使用XIRR函数计算回报率

  1. 输入公式:在一个新的单元格中输入公式。例如,如果日期列是A2到A10,金额列是B2到B10,你可以在C2单元格中输入公式:
    =XIRR(B2:B10, A2:A10)

XIRR函数将返回整个投资组合的不规则现金流的内部回报率。

四、实际应用案例

4.1 案例背景

假设你有一个投资组合,包括股票、债券和房地产,期初价值分别为100,000元、50,000元和150,000元。经过一年后,期末价值分别为120,000元、52,000元和160,000元,期间股票和债券都发放了分红,分别为2,000元和1,000元。

4.2 计算步骤

  1. 输入数据

    投资项目 期初价值 期末价值 分红
    股票 100,000 120,000 2,000
    债券 50,000 52,000 1,000
    房地产 150,000 160,000 0
  2. 计算回报率

    股票回报率 = (120,000 - 100,000 + 2,000) / 100,000 = 0.22

    债券回报率 = (52,000 - 50,000 + 1,000) / 50,000 = 0.06

    房地产回报率 = (160,000 - 150,000) / 150,000 = 0.067

  3. 计算权重

    股票权重 = 100,000 / 300,000 = 0.3333

    债券权重 = 50,000 / 300,000 = 0.1667

    房地产权重 = 150,000 / 300,000 = 0.5

  4. 计算权重回报率

    股票权重回报率 = 0.22 * 0.3333 = 0.0733

    债券权重回报率 = 0.06 * 0.1667 = 0.01

    房地产权重回报率 = 0.067 * 0.5 = 0.0335

  5. 汇总加权平均回报率

    加权平均回报率 = 0.0733 + 0.01 + 0.0335 = 0.1168

通过上述步骤,我们得到了该投资组合的加权平均回报率为11.68%。

五、常见问题及解答

5.1 数据输入错误

在输入数据时,确保所有的期初价值、期末价值和分红都正确无误,以免影响计算结果。

5.2 使用XIRR函数时的日期格式问题

确保日期格式正确,建议使用Excel的日期格式工具进行设置,以免出现函数错误。

5.3 投资项目数量过多

如果投资项目数量较多,可以使用Excel的筛选和排序功能,方便进行数据管理和计算。

六、总结

通过上述方法,你可以在Excel中轻松计算投资组合的回报率。使用基本公式可以帮助你快速了解每个投资项目的表现,权重平均法可以综合考虑各个投资项目的比例,XIRR函数则适用于复杂的时间序列回报计算。无论你选择哪种方法,都可以帮助你更好地管理和评估你的投资组合。

无论你是新手投资者还是有经验的投资专家,掌握这些Excel计算方法,都将为你的投资决策提供有力支持。希望这篇文章能够帮助你更好地理解和应用Excel计算投资组合回报率的方法。

相关问答FAQs:

1. 投资组合回报率是什么?
投资组合回报率是指投资者在一段时间内从投资组合中获得的总回报,通常以百分比的形式表示。

2. 如何在Excel中计算投资组合回报率?
在Excel中,可以使用以下公式来计算投资组合回报率:首先,将投资组合中各个资产的回报率乘以其对应的权重,然后将所有资产的加权回报率相加即可得到投资组合的回报率。

3. Excel中如何计算投资组合权重?
要计算投资组合中各个资产的权重,可以使用以下公式:首先,将每个资产在投资组合中的市值除以整个投资组合的总市值,然后将所有资产的权重相加即可得到投资组合的总权重。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4164431

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部